Park Landscape Maintenance in Ventura County, CA

Park landscape maintenance services encompass a range of routine and seasonal tasks designed to keep outdoor spaces attractive, healthy, and functional. These services often include lawn mowing, trimming, edging, pruning shrubs and trees, weed control, and seasonal plant care. Property owners typically seek these services to maintain a well-groomed appearance, promote plant health, and ensure safety by removing overgrown or hazardous vegetation. Before requesting maintenance, it’s helpful to consider the size and complexity of the landscape, the specific plants or features involved, and any preferences for appearance or scheduling to ensure the service meets the property's unique needs.

Understanding the scope of park landscape maintenance can also involve clarifying which areas require attention, such as lawns, flower beds, pathways, or recreational spaces. Property owners often want to know about the frequency of service, the types of equipment used, and any preparation needed beforehand. Clear communication about these details can help ensure that the maintenance aligns with the property's aesthetic goals and ongoing care requirements, resulting in an inviting and well-maintained outdoor environment.

Common Park Landscape Maintenance Jobs

Lawn mowing and trimming - regular maintenance to keep grass neat and healthy.

Garden bed care - weed removal, edging, and mulch application for a tidy appearance.

Tree and shrub pruning - shaping and thinning to promote growth and safety.

Seasonal cleanups - debris removal and yard clearing for a fresh look each season.

Irrigation system maintenance - ensuring efficient watering and system functionality.

Landscape planting - selecting and installing plants to enhance curb appeal.

Park Landscape Maintenance Questions

What types of landscape maintenance services are available? Services include lawn mowing, trimming, edging, shrub and tree pruning, and seasonal cleanup to keep landscapes tidy and healthy.

How often should a property be maintained? Maintenance frequency depends on the landscape’s needs and property size, typically ranging from weekly to monthly schedules.

What should property owners consider before scheduling maintenance? It's important to assess the landscape’s condition, desired appearance, and any specific plant care requirements.

Are there services for seasonal landscape adjustments? Yes, services often include seasonal pruning, leaf removal, and preparing landscapes for different weather conditions.
